Does higher cardiorespiratory fitness improve metabolic, inflammatory, and oxidative stress biomarkers in adults?
Higher cardiorespiratory fitness is associated with improved metabolic and redox profiles, suggesting a functional CRF threshold could be a practical target to reduce cardiometabolic risk.
correlated with healthier metabolic profiles, less inflammation, and higher antioxidant expression, while inversely correlating with HOMA-IR, MDA, and TNFα. Optimal or high CRF strongly protects against insulin resistance, oxidative stress, inflammation, and metabolic inflexibility, key hallmarks of sedentary behaviour. Regular physical exercise improves metabolic and redox profiles, enhancing antioxidant defences in PBMCs. A functional CRF threshold represents a practical target by which to reduce cardiometabolic risk.
